Fear of Missing Out (FOMO)

It’s time to take a closer look at one of the most powerful emotional drivers in crypto trading – the Fear of Missing Out, or FOMO.

What is FOMO?

FOMO is the feeling that you’re missing out on a golden opportunity.

In crypto trading, it’s the fear that if you don’t invest in a particular cryptocurrency right now, you’ll miss out on huge profits.

This fear can be incredibly compelling and often pushes traders into making impulsive decisions.

Real-Life Examples of FOMO in Crypto

Think of FOMO as that voice in your head telling you to buy a cryptocurrency just because everyone else is.

You’ve probably heard stories of people who invested in a relatively unknown coin and saw their investments multiply overnight.

FOMO can lead you to chase those stories without understanding the fundamentals of the coin, the risks involved, or the long-term potential.

The Dangers of FOMO

FOMO can be a trader’s worst enemy.

It often leads to:

  1. Impulsive Decisions: FOMO-driven traders buy at the peak of a rally, only to see the price drop shortly after.
  2. Overtrading: They may frequently buy and sell in an attempt to catch the latest trend, racking up trading fees and losing profits in the process.
  3. Ignoring Research: FOMO-driven traders often skip the due diligence phase, neglecting to research a coin’s technology, team, and adoption potential.
  4. Emotional Turmoil: The fear of missing out can cause anxiety and stress, which is counterproductive for making rational decisions.

How to Overcome FOMO in Crypto

So, how can you conquer the FOMO demon?

Here are some practical tips for staying level-headed:

  1. Educate Yourself: Take the time to understand the cryptocurrency you’re considering. Research the technology, the team behind it, and its real-world use cases.
  2. Set Clear Goals: Determine your investment goals, whether it’s long-term holding or short-term trading, and stick to your plan.
  3. Avoid Herd Mentality: Just because everyone is investing in a certain coin doesn’t mean you should too. Trust your own research and judgment.
  4. Use Stop-Loss Orders: These automatically sell your assets if their value falls below a certain point, helping to limit losses in the event of a market downturn.

Fear of Loss (FOL): The Other Side of the Coin

In crypto trading, the Fear of Loss (FOL) is just as prevalent as the Fear of Missing Out (FOMO).

Understanding and managing FOL is essential for maintaining a healthy and rational approach to trading.

What is FOL?

FOL, as the name suggests, is the fear of losing your investment in the crypto market.

It’s the emotional response to the possibility of your crypto decreasing in value, which is a very real concern in this highly volatile market.

How FOL Affects Crypto Traders

FOL can have a significant impact on crypto traders in the following ways:

  1. Paralysis: FOL can lead to a state of analysis paralysis, where traders are too afraid to make any moves out of fear of losing what they have.
  2. Panic Selling: When prices start to drop, FOL-driven traders may engage in panic selling, often at a loss, to avoid further declines.
  3. Short-Term Focus: Traders overtaken by FOL may become excessively short-term focused, leading to impulsive, reactive decisions instead of adhering to a well-thought-out strategy.
  4. Emotional Stress: Constant worry about losses can lead to significant emotional stress and negatively affect overall mental well-being.

Strategies to Deal with FOL

Overcoming FOL is essential for successful crypto trading.

Here are strategies to help you manage and mitigate this fear:

  1. Risk Management: Always set stop-loss orders, as mentioned earlier. This helps limit potential losses and provides a sense of security.
  2. Diversify Your Portfolio: Spreading your investments across different cryptocurrencies can help reduce the impact of losses on your overall portfolio.
  3. Long-Term Perspective: Remember that the crypto market has historically experienced significant fluctuations, but it has also shown long-term growth. A long-term perspective can ease concerns about short-term volatility.
  4. Education: The more you understand the technology, the market, and the fundamentals of the cryptocurrencies you invest in, the more confident and less fearful you will be.
  5. Emotional Control: Techniques like deep breathing, meditation, and mindfulness can help you keep your emotions in check and make rational decisions.

Developing a Calm Crypto Trading Mindset

Amid a highly volatile crypto market, it’s crucial to cultivate a calm and rational trading mindset.

Emotions can often cloud judgment and lead to impulsive decisions.

Let’s explore how you can build the mental resilience required to navigate the crypto trading world successfully.

1. Recognizing and Managing Emotions

Emotions play a significant role in trading. Fear, greed, and excitement can lead to impulsive actions.

Recognizing when emotions are taking over is the first step to managing them.

Here’s how:

  • Stay Self-Aware: Regularly check in with yourself to assess your emotions while trading. Are you feeling anxious, overconfident, or fearful? Understanding your emotional state can help you make more rational decisions.
  • Set Rules: Establish a clear set of trading rules and guidelines that you follow regardless of your emotional state. These rules can act as a safety net during turbulent times.

2. The Importance of Patience

Patience is a virtue in crypto trading.

Understand that quick profits are rare, and the market can be unpredictable.

Here’s how patience can benefit you:

  • Long-Term Thinking: Focusing on long-term goals and holding your investments can often yield better results than constantly buying and selling based on short-term market movements.
  • Resisting Impulse: A patient trader is less likely to make impulsive decisions influenced by emotions or market noise.

3. Staying Informed and Setting Realistic Goals

Keeping yourself informed about the crypto market and setting achievable goals can contribute to a more composed trading mindset:

  • Continuous Learning: Stay updated with the latest news and trends in the crypto world. Knowledge can give you confidence and reduce uncertainty.
  • Realistic Expectations: Understand that not every trade will be a winning one. Setting realistic profit goals and accepting losses as a part of the trading process is essential.

4. Building a Crypto Trading Plan

A well-structured trading plan can be your anchor in the stormy seas of crypto trading.

Here’s what a trading plan should include:

  • Entry and Exit Strategies: Define clear entry and exit points for your trades. Knowing when to take profits and cut losses can keep emotions in check.
  • Risk Management: Calculate how much you’re willing to risk on each trade and stick to it. This ensures you don’t let FOL or FOMO drive your actions.
  • Diversification: Decide how you’ll diversify your portfolio to spread risk and minimize the impact of any single asset’s price movement.
  • Review and Adapt: Periodically review and adapt your trading plan based on your experiences and changes in the market.

A calm trading mindset is your best asset in the crypto market.

It allows you to stay focused on your long-term goals, avoid impulsive decisions, and navigate the waves of volatility with confidence.

Common Mistakes to Avoid in Crypto Trading

Crypto trading can be treacherous for beginners, but by recognizing and avoiding common pitfalls, you can significantly improve your chances of success.

Here are some mistakes to steer clear of:

1. Chasing Hyped Coins

Avoid investing in a crypto solely because it’s currently popular or being heavily promoted.

Hyped coins can be subject to rapid price drops.

2. Ignoring Research

Never invest without thoroughly researching the cryptocurrency.

Understand its technology, use cases, the team behind it, and its long-term potential.

3. Emotional Trading

Emotional trading, driven by FOMO or FOL, often leads to impulsive decisions.

Stick to your trading plan, which should be based on rational analysis, not emotions.

4. Overtrading

Frequent buying and selling may lead to high transaction fees and can erode your profits.

Trading excessively is risky and often unproductive.

5. Neglecting Risk Management

Failing to set stop-loss orders or risking more than you can afford to lose can result in significant losses.

Always have a clear risk management strategy in place.

6. Lack of a Trading Plan

Trading without a well-defined plan is like sailing without a map.

A trading plan helps you set clear goals, strategies, and rules for your trading activities.

7. Holding Too Long

While it’s important to have a long-term perspective, holding onto a cryptocurrency regardless of deteriorating fundamentals can lead to losses.

Don’t be afraid to cut your losses if necessary.

8. Ignoring Security

Failing to secure your crypto assets can make you susceptible to hacks and scams.

Use reputable wallets/exchanges, enable two-factor authentication, and safeguard your private keys.

9. Falling for Scams

Be cautious of offers that promise unbelievable returns or ask for your private information or investments.

Scams are prevalent in the crypto world.

[READ: Most Common Crypto Scams and How to Avoid Them]

10. Overconfidence

Even after a few successful trades, it’s important not to become overconfident.

The crypto market is unpredictable, and overconfidence can lead to reckless decisions.

By avoiding these common mistakes and taking a cautious, well-researched approach to crypto trading, you can increase your chances of success and minimize the risks associated with this exciting but volatile market.
